A delicate, monoline script with smooth, continuous strokes and rounded terminals. Letterforms are tall and slender, with generous ascenders/descenders and frequent looped joins, especially in the lowercase. The rhythm is gently bouncy, with subtle baseline play and soft, open counters; capitals lean toward simple, calligraphic constructions with occasional flourish-like entry strokes. Spacing is moderately open for a script, keeping words legible while preserving a handwritten flow.

This font suits short to medium-length display copy where a graceful handwritten feel is desired—wedding materials, greeting cards, boutique branding, labels, and social posts. It works best at larger sizes where the thin strokes and looped joins can remain clear, and where its lively rhythm can function as a visual feature rather than body text.

The overall tone feels lighthearted and refined—romantic without being overly formal. Its looping joins and airy construction give it a personable, handwritten charm that reads as approachable and slightly whimsical, suited to warm, celebratory messaging.

The design appears intended to emulate neat, carefully penned handwriting with a touch of flourish—prioritizing elegance and flow over strict formality. Its consistent line weight and tall proportions suggest a decorative script meant to add personality and warmth to headlines and names.

Uppercase characters generally stay restrained and readable, while lowercase forms carry most of the personality through long loops (notably in letters like f, g, j, y, and z). Numerals are simple and consistent with the line weight, with rounded shapes that match the script’s softness.
